Glass-Reinforced Plastic Production Process $90K OSHA Fine

OSHA's inspection found that combustible particulate solids, which were generated during trimming and repair operations, were not collected into an adequately designed dust collection system, were allowed to accumulate on machinery and surfaces, and were not adequately cleaned up to prevent such buildup.

Housekeeping appears to be the major issue with this recent OSHA citation for combustible dust fire and explosion hazards at a Pawcatuck, Connecticut plant. Reviewing a MSDS sheet for glass-reinforced plastics (GRP) highlights that GRP is a compound based upon a mix of glass fibre in a polyester and styrene resin based mix.

The fire hazards of GRP arise when combustible dust from machining and fabrication operations of combustible particulate solids may be explosive if mixed with air in critical proportions in the presence of an ignition source. Additionally, during storage and handling the dust generated during normal manufacturing operations can represent both a health hazard and a fire hazard. Most importantly as the OSHA news release informs stakeholders to use dust control equipment at the point of generation in machining and sawing operations.

An often overlooked potential ignition source are powered industrial trucks where combustible dust mentioned in this news release was exposed to several potential ignition sources, including an LP gas-powered industrial truck. What class of forklift are you using at your facility? Is it rated for use in potentially explosive atmospheres? The recent status report on the OSHA Combustible Dust NEP emphasized that combustible dust citations for powered industrial trucks was the third most cited violation after hazardous communication and housekeeping violations.

Good housekeeping is a major issue at facilities with the generation of combustible dust from combustible particulate solids. Many facility managers and owners are not aware of the proper methods in cleaning up the dust. You just can't take a compressed air hose and start blowing down the area nor sweeping while unaware of the dust clouds that can be generated, which provide an explosive atmosphere similar to a flammable vapor cloud. Potential ignition sources in the process are inherent at many facilities. The safe and approved alternative is the use of an explosive-proof rated vacuum cleaner.

CAL-OSHA

According to the OSHA IMIS citation and violation data, CAL-OSHA has not written a single OSHA 1910.178. C01 or C02 citation between Jan 1, 2003 and the present. Yet according to the NFIRS data approximately 432 fires were started by powered industrial equipment in California between 2003 and 2007.

As a matter of fact OSHA regions 9 and 10 (entire West Coast region) experienced approximately 600 and 742 fires respectively (according to the NFIRS), while only one (1) OSHA 1910.178. C01 citation was written (Nevada in 2003) between Jan 1, 2003 and the present in both regions.

I can only wonder why CAL-OSHA publishes an article about equipment fire and explosion safety while they appear to have completely ignored enforcement of the issue for at least 6 years?

Equipment approvals:
It is true that UL approved EX diesel equipment is hard to find, for that matter none existent. This is due to the fact that UL never develop HAZLOC codes, regulations, construction specification or testing procedures for IC powered industrial equipment used in explosion hazardous areas.

ATEX ATmosphères EXplosibles
OSHA however has not objected to the use of ATEX compliant conversion in explosion hazardous areas in US as long as it passes a hazardous equivalency test and evidence of certification can be provided. OSHA has not cited companies using internationally certified EX equipment because of two little know OSHA enforcement facts:

1. OSHA has the “burden of proof” that equipment is unsafe
2. OSHA will allow the use of international certified equipment if not US certified alternative exists

ATEX certified solutions are available to industry and they meet both criteria, especially when it comes to diesel powered explosion proof equipment.

OSHA Powered Industrial Trucks
And these equipment type suitability/approval claims:

“OSHA’s diesel designations include DS (with safeguards to the exhaust, fuel and electrical systems) and DY (with all the safeguards of DS units plus temperature limitation features). The only forklifts approved for Division 1 hazardous locations are electric-powered, designated EX (with safeguards for use in atmospheres containing flammable vapors or dusts). DS, DY, EE (enclosed electrical equipment) and EX are approved for Division 2.”

Crucial Mistake
Unfortunately OSHA is making a commonly made crucial mistake by implying the suitability of UL approved DS, DY and EE equipment types for use in explosion hazardous areas. UL does not test, certify or approve the use of these equipment types for use in explosion hazardous areas. If equipment is tested and certified for hazardous areas, the appropriate hazardous area classification will be shown on the ID tag of the equipment. If contact your equipment OEM or UL for a written statement of the hazardous area suitability of the of DS, DY and EE type you will be able to quickly verify this info.

OSHA PIT 1910.178 violations where third most cited violation according to the recent OSHA status report of the Dust NEP program


Robert Zuiderveld analyzed OHSA citations given for OSHA 1910.178 C02 violations for powered industrial trucks (use of improper equipment types in explosion hazardous areas) between 2003 and 2008.

2003 - 10 citations
2004 -18 citations
2005 -14 citations
2006 -16 citations
2007 -18 citations
2008 -31 citations


Units Sold

During that same time the following estimated number of “rated” forklift trucks (“S”, EE & DY types) were sold based on a 2% market share of total trucks sold (figure agreed upon by forklift OEMs)

2003 - approx. 2800 ES, EE, LPS, DS, DY units sold
2004 - approx. 3300, ES, EE, LPS, DS, DY units sold
2005 - approx. 3600, ES, EE, LPS, DS, DY units sold
2006 - approx. 3800, ES, EE, LPS, DS, DY units sold
2007 - approx. 3500, ES, EE, LPS, DS, DY units sold
2008 - approx. 3000, ES, EE, LPS, DS, DY units sold


Fires

According to the National Fire Incident Reporting System (NFIRS) during this same time period the following number of fires were ignited by forklift trucks and loader:

2003 – 532 fires (+/- 2233 fires if you incl. construction equipment, cranes and misc ind. equipment)
2004 - 572 fires (+/- 2469 fires if you incl. construction equipment, cranes and misc ind. equipment)
2005 - 657 fires (+/- 2795 fires if you incl. construction equipment, cranes and misc ind. equipment)
2006 -686 fires(+/- 2982 fires if you incl. construction equipment, cranes and misc ind. equipment)
2007 -795 fires (+/- 3149 fires if you incl. construction equipment, cranes and misc ind. equipment)
2008 –not available yet


Equipment Protection Levels

Based on this data, it appears that OSHA inspectors may lack the ability to recognize equipment protection levels and equipment type’s suitability allowing the use of equipment types which are not tested, certified or suitable for use in the Class I and Class II explosion hazardous areas.

Additionally it appears that OSHA enforcement and fines are inconsistent. Citations for 1910.178 C02 are none existent or far and few between in some of the states with the highest number of forklift fires. http://www.pyroban.us/NFIRS-data.htm

If you are located in CA for example you have nothing to worry about. CAL-OSHA appears to be too busy with CARB to address equipment fire safety issues.

Fines have been relatively low ($250 – $2500), unless you have an incident that arouses OSHA scrutiny. Then things get really ugly really quick.

John called me and asked, " if getting a letter from a AHJ other than OSHA stating that the use of "S" type equipment in 1910.178 - Powered industrial trucks. 1910.178(c) Designated locations, Dust hazardous areas is OK and would satisfy OSHA regulatory requirements?"

NFPA 70 (aka NEC):
I always go back to this document since it is one of the few that get regularly updated and actually offers good answers to many questions in article 500:

Page 70-360 paragraph 500.8(A) states: Suitability of identified equipment shall be determined by one of the following:

(1) Equipment listing or labeling
(2) Evidence of equipment evaluation from a qualified testing laboratory or inspection agency concerned with product evaluation (RZ note: NOT necessarily and NRTL).
(3) Evidence acceptable to the authority having jurisdiction such as a manufacturer’s self evaluation or an owners engineering judgment.

Authority Having Jurisdiction (AHJ).
An organization, office, or individual responsible for enforcing the requirements of a code or standard, or for approving equipment, materials, an installation, or a procedure.

FPN: The phrase "authority having jurisdiction," or its acronym AHJ, is used in NFPA documents in a broad manner, since jurisdictions and approval agencies vary, as do their responsibilities. Where public safety is primary, the authority having jurisdiction may be a federal, state, local, or other regional department or individual such as a fire chief; fire marshal; chief of a fire prevention bureau, labor department, or health department: building official; electrical inspector; or others having statutory authority.

For insurance purposes, an insurance inspection department, rating bureau, or other insurance company representative may be the authority having jurisdiction. In many circumstances, the property owner or his or her designated agent assumes the role of the authority having jurisdiction; at government installations, the commanding officer or departmental official may be the authority having jurisdiction.

At the end of the day the burden of proof that equipment is unsafe rests on OSHA shoulders. You can get a letter from the Pope, but if OSHA can easily prove that your practices endanger the welfare of your employees then you are in violation. If they take you to court, and evidence is so obvious that they are right, you are out of even more money. This is the case with using any UL approved “S” type in any explosion hazardous areas. It is not a question if it is going to happen, more a question of when?

If you don’t wear a seat belt while driving a car, you will be fine until you get into an accident. If you use UL approved "S" type equipment in explosion hazardous areas you will most likely start a fire or blow yourself when an accidental release takes place.

It is possible to challenge a OSHA judgment, but you must be able to substantiate your claims and provide evidence. Historic fact is not a solid defense in the age of IT. -Robert Zuiderveld

Robert is referring to type S equipment, in NFPA 505, which you'll find in the top row of Table 4.2 Summary Table on Use of Powered Industrial Trucks.

In row 13, For Class II Division 2 Group G, you'll notice 11 different types of equipment that are listed, seven which require AHJ approval. But thats the problem, these haven't be certified for explosive atmosphere. Only EX is certified for explosive atmosphere by UL.
